The Expression And Significance Of Mismatch Repair Gene HMLH1 And HMSH2 In The Canceration Process From Hepatolithiasis To Cholangiocarcinoma

Objective:To detect the relative content of hMSH2 and hMLH1 in different bile duct cells of hepatolithiasis and cholangiocarcinoma patients,research the expression and significance of hMSH2 and hMLH1 in the process of intrahepatic bile duct carcinogenesis.Methods:To detect the relative content of hMSH2 and hMLH1 in normal intrahepatic bile duct tissues (control group),less than ten years (Calculus group 1) and more than ten years (Calculus group 2) bile duct tissues of hepatolithiasis patients,choledocholithiasis and cholangiocarcinoma tissues(cholangiocarcinoma group) by fluorescence quantitative PCR.Results:The relative content of hMSH2 and hMLH1 is highest in normal group,calculus group is higher than cholangiocarcinoma group,it is significantly different among normal group,calculus group and cholangiocarcinoma group (P<0.05).The relative content of hMSH2 and hMLHl of calculus group 1 is higher than calculus group 2,it is significantly different between two groups(P<0.05). The relative content of hMSH2 and hMLH1 of cholangiocarcinoma group is lower than calculus group 2.Conclusions:The long-term stimulation of intrahepatic bile duct stones can lead to the different hMSH2 and hMLH1 express, and with the extension of intrahepatic bile duct stimulate, the expression is lower. The expression of hMSH2 and hMLH1 in cholangiocarcinoma group is lowest, prompt that hMLH1, hMSH2 is intrahepatic bile duct with long-term inflammatory stimulation cause bile duct cancer is one of the important factors.
